
Jongno Private House is situated in the vibrant Jongno-Gu district of Seoul, offering easy access to several local landmarks. It is located just 3 km away from Bangsan Market, 3.3 km from Jongmyo Shrine, and another 3.3 km from the historical Changgyeonggung Palace. Guests will also find Gwangjang Market only 2.6 km from the guest house, providing a lively atmosphere and local delicacies. The property features a communal kitchen, allowing visitors to prepare their meals, and encourages a friendly, home-like environment.
Throughout the accommodation, complimentary WiFi is accessible, ensuring that guests can stay connected and share their experiences. In addition to local attractions, Dongdaemun Market, famous for its shopping and nightlife, is just 2 km away, making it a convenient spot for those interested in exploring the area.
This air-conditioned guest house is equipped with modern conveniences, featuring a spacious dining area and a fully equipped kitchen that includes a microwave. Visitors can also enjoy entertainment on a cable flat-screen TV available in the accommodation. The guest house maintains a non-smoking environment, prioritizing the comfort and well-being of all its guests.
Nearby, Changdeokgung Palace, known for its stunning gardens and traditional architecture, lies just 3.4 km from the guest house, while the Shilla Duty Free Shop Main Store is located approximately 3.6 km away, providing guests the chance to shop for international brands and local souvenirs.
For travelers flying in, the closest airport to Jongno Private House is Gimpo International Airport, situated around 22 km from the property. This accessibility makes it an ideal choice for visitors looking to explore the rich cultural heritage of Seoul while enjoying comfortable accommodations.

Nestled in the heart of Seoul, the Jongno Private House offers visitors a perfect base for exploring the vibrant surroundings. This area is rich in history and culture, with many touristic places nearby that showcase the essence of South Korea.
One of the most prominent attractions is Gyeongbokgung Palace, a regal site that dates back to the Joseon Dynasty. Visitors can admire its stunning architecture and observe the changing of the guard ceremony, which is a must-see. Just a short distance away, Changdeokgung Palace and its Secret Garden provide a tranquil escape where nature and heritage intertwine beautifully.
- Insadong: A bustling neighborhood known for its traditional tea houses, art galleries, and shops selling handmade crafts.
- Bukchon Hanok Village: This charming area is filled with traditional Korean houses, offering a picturesque view of history amidst urban development.
- Namsan Tower: An iconic landmark providing panoramic views of the city, particularly stunning at sunset.
For those interested in contemporary culture, the Hongdae district is a vibrant area nearby, teeming with live music, street performances, and youthful energy. Visitors can enjoy various cafes, shops, and the lively nightlife that this area is known for.
The Jogyesa Temple is another key highlight, serving as the center of Zen Buddhism in Korea. Its tranquil atmosphere and beautiful surroundings make it a perfect spot for reflection and peace. If one seeks a deeper understanding of Korean culture, the National Museum of Korea is easily accessible and offers an extensive collection of artifacts.
- Dongdaemun Design Plaza: A futuristic complex that hosts exhibitions, fashion shows, and art installations.
- Cheonggyecheon Stream: A beautifully restored stream ideal for a leisurely walk, lined with art installations and greenery.
- Namdaemun Market: A traditional market where visitors can sample local delicacies and shop for various goods.
As the day winds down, the vibrant streets of Myeongdong offer tantalizing street food options, ranging from tteokbokki to hotteok. With so much to see and do, the Jongno area serves as a gateway to experiencing the rich tapestry of Seoul’s history, art, and culinary delights.
